Hotels Near Mallard Lake
Hotels Near Mallard Lake
49 Reviews
7.9
$98.32 per nightSelect
7 Reviews
8.5
$104.00 per nightSelect
1 Reviews
7.6
$102.50 per nightSelect
2 Reviews
10
$107.10 per nightSelect
9 Reviews
8.2
$117.50 per nightSelect
2 Reviews
7.9
$92.65 per nightSelect
91 Reviews
8.3
$170.51 per nightSelect
6 Reviews
9.7
$90.63 per nightSelect
40 Reviews
8.4
$80.74 per nightSelect
6 Reviews
8.1
$104.13 per nightSelect
16 Reviews
8.9
$105.93 per nightSelect
277 Reviews
7.9
$85.67 per nightSelect
82 Reviews
7.2
$49.99 per nightSelect
24 Reviews
8
$139.88 per nightSelect
3 Reviews
9.7
$102.50 per nightSelect
18 Reviews
8.3
$85.43 per nightSelect
19 Reviews
8.1
$115.00 per nightSelect
21 Reviews
8.3
$125.00 per nightSelect
87 Reviews
8.4
$101.11 per nightSelect
Map of Hotels Near Mallard Lake
Top Activities Near Mallard Lake
Filter By Date
//
Sort By